>> By the way, if you have typed a method or class name in your source
>> code and want to see the documentation for it, just
>> option-double-click on it.
>
> That's pretty nice, and leads to what'll be my first feedback: There's
> no (apparent) documentation for NSRect and NSPoint. Not that there's
> much to them, but if something like option-double-click works for some
> NS* stuff it should work for all of it, IMHO, even if that means just
> bringing up the appropriate header file so that I can see the
> definition.
There are definitely still some bugs. :) Specifically, right now the
lookup should work reliably for classes and methods (although not
delegate methods, and in the December tools release I believe methods
added by another framework are also not working -- these are quite rare,
and we have a fix for the next release). Constants and types are less
reliable; we're working on making them more so. I'd recommend filing a
bug report saying that in the case of option-double-click, if there's no
documentation PB should fall back to just displaying the header file.
